0
0
Lập trình
NM

Giải Quyết Vấn Đề Chạy Ứng Dụng React Native Trên Android

Đăng vào 7 tháng trước

• 3 phút đọc

Giới Thiệu

Chào các bạn lập trình viên! 👋 Trong bài viết này, chúng ta sẽ cùng tìm hiểu về cách khắc phục vấn đề không thể chạy ứng dụng React Native trên trình giả lập Android từ Visual Studio Code. Việc này thường gặp phải đối với những người mới bắt đầu, và chúng tôi sẽ cung cấp các giải pháp cụ thể, cũng như những mẹo hữu ích để giúp bạn vượt qua khó khăn này.

Nội Dung Bài Viết

Các bước chuẩn bị

Trước khi bắt đầu, hãy đảm bảo rằng bạn đã thực hiện các bước chuẩn bị sau:

  • Cài đặt Android Studio: Đảm bảo rằng bạn đã cài đặt Android Studio và cấu hình một trình giả lập.
  • Cài đặt React Native CLI: Sử dụng lệnh npm install -g react-native-cli để cài đặt.
  • Cấu hình môi trường: Kiểm tra biến môi trường để đảm bảo đường dẫn đến Java và Android SDK đã được thiết lập đúng.

Vấn đề thường gặp

Khi bạn đã hoàn tất các bước chuẩn bị nhưng vẫn gặp phải vấn đề, có thể có một số nguyên nhân như sau:

  • Metro bundler không chạy: Đảm bảo rằng Metro bundler đang chạy mà không có lỗi gì.
  • Không thấy nút “Run” trong VS Code: Đây là vấn đề phổ biến mà nhiều lập trình viên mới gặp phải.
  • Lỗi khi chạy lệnh npx react-native run-android: Nếu lệnh này không hoạt động, có thể có vấn đề với cấu hình của bạn.

Giải pháp

Dưới đây là một số giải pháp để bạn thử:

  1. Khởi động lại Metro bundler: Đôi khi, việc khởi động lại có thể giải quyết được vấn đề.
  2. Sử dụng lệnh từ terminal: Thay vì sử dụng nút “Run”, bạn có thể mở terminal trong VS Code và chạy lệnh npx react-native run-android.
  3. Cài đặt Extensions: Có một số extensions trong VS Code có thể giúp bạn quản lý ứng dụng React Native tốt hơn. Một số extension bạn có thể thử là: React Native Tools.
  4. Kiểm tra cài đặt VS Code: Đảm bảo rằng bạn đã cấu hình đúng các thiết lập trong VS Code để hỗ trợ React Native.

Mẹo tối ưu hóa

  • Sử dụng phím tắt: Để thêm nút “Run”, bạn có thể cấu hình phím tắt trong VS Code bằng cách vào mục Keyboard Shortcuts và tìm kiếm lệnh chạy.
  • Kiểm tra log: Sử dụng console log để theo dõi các lỗi có thể xảy ra trong quá trình chạy ứng dụng.
  • Tối ưu hóa mã nguồn: Đảm bảo rằng mã nguồn của bạn không có lỗi cú pháp và các import cần thiết đã được thêm đầy đủ.

Lỗi và cách khắc phục

  • Lỗi không tìm thấy thiết bị: Nếu bạn gặp thông báo lỗi không tìm thấy thiết bị, hãy kiểm tra lại trình giả lập và đảm bảo nó đang chạy.
  • Lỗi kết nối: Đảm bảo rằng thiết bị giả lập có thể kết nối với Metro bundler. Kiểm tra lại địa chỉ IP và cổng.

Kết luận

Hy vọng rằng những thông tin và giải pháp trên sẽ giúp bạn giải quyết vấn đề khi chạy ứng dụng React Native trên Android. Nếu bạn còn thắc mắc hay cần thêm thông tin, đừng ngần ngại để lại câu hỏi dưới bài viết này. Chúng tôi luôn sẵn sàng hỗ trợ bạn! 🙏

Câu hỏi thường gặp (FAQ)

1. Tại sao không thấy nút “Run” trong VS Code?

  • Có thể bạn cần cài đặt extension React Native Tools để có tính năng này.

2. Làm thế nào để khắc phục lỗi khi chạy lệnh npx react-native run-android?

  • Kiểm tra lại cấu hình môi trường và đảm bảo rằng Metro bundler đang chạy mà không có lỗi.

3. Có cách nào khác để chạy ứng dụng không?

  • Bạn có thể sử dụng terminal trong VS Code để chạy lệnh thay vì nút “Run”.
Gợi ý câu hỏi phỏng vấn
Không có dữ liệu

Không có dữ liệu

Bài viết được đề xuất
Bài viết cùng tác giả

Bình luận

Chưa có bình luận nào

Chưa có bình luận nào